Summary What will the pretty little fly do when she is asked to join the big, hairy spider in his parlor? The fly has heard that those who visit the spider never come back, but the scary spider tries to trick the innocent fly. This dark fable, by accomplished writer and poet Mary Howitt, has been a favorite for generations. Now Davina Porter's charming narration illuminates the cautionary tale for a whole new audience.
